云计算技术的迅猛发展正在重新定义操作系统的角色及其功能。传统操作系统一般运行在本地设备上,主要负责管理硬件资源、提供用户界面和执行应用程序。随着云平台的普及,操作系统不得不适应这一变化,从而不仅仅是对硬件的控制者,更成为了云服务体系中的核心组成部分。

深入分析云平台带来的影响,性能评测显示,云操作系统的效率和响应速度取得了显著提升。现代云服务通过虚拟化技术,使得资源分配更加灵活、动态。这种资源的按需分配,能够极大地减少冗余,提高服务器的使用效率。以Docker和Kubernetes为代表的容器化技术,使得多个应用能够在同一环境中并行运行,减少了传统虚拟机的大量开销。
市场趋势显示,越来越多的企业倾向于选择云原生架构。云原生操作系统如Red Hat OpenShift和Google的GKE,具备了自动伸缩、自愈合和负载均衡等特性,让操作系统的使用更加高效、便捷。根据最新的市场调研,预计到2025年,云服务市场将以超过20%的年增长率继续扩张。这一数据反映出企业对提高IT灵活性和降低运营成本的需求日益增加,而操作系统作为云生态系统中的一环,自然要适应这一变化。
在DIY组装云计算平台的过程中,选用合适的操作系统尤为关键。对于需要高可用性、可伸缩性的应用,可以考虑使用具有强大支持能力的Linux发行版,如Ubuntu或CentOS。通过学习如何有效配置这些操作系统的网络、存储和计算资源,能够帮助用户更好地满足业务需求。加强对容器技术的掌握,例如Docker和Kubernetes的使用,可以让自组装的环境更加高效,并且可以快速应对流量变化。
性能优化方面,云操作系统的设计已开始强调自动化及智能化。通过引入机器学习算法,云操作系统能够实时分析运行状态,自动调整资源分配,确保服务的高可用性和低延迟。企业可以通过monitoring工具持续观察系统性能分析,识别瓶颈并进行针对性的优化。例如,利用Prometheus和Grafana进行监控和可视化,能够有效提升运维效率,减少人工干预,提高系统稳定性。
未来,云操作系统将逐步演变,融合边缘计算与人工智能等新兴技术。未来操作系统将更加关注用户体验以及跨平台的无缝操作,致力于提供更高效、更智能的解决方案。
常见问题解答(FAQ)
1. 什么是云操作系统?
云操作系统是专为云计算环境设计的操作系统,它能够高效管理云资源,并提供支持云原生应用运行的基础设施。
2. 云平台如何影响传统操作系统的使用?
云平台提供了更高的灵活性和扩展性,使得传统操作系统需要转变为云友好的系统,支持虚拟化和容器化技术。
3. DIY云平台需要注意哪些操作系统选择?
选择Linux等适合云服务的操作系统,配置网络和存储,确保可以支持容器技术及数据的快速处理。
4. 如何优化云操作系统的性能?
引入监控工具,利用机器学习算法实时调整资源,分析系统性能瓶颈并进行优化,能有效提升操作系统的性能。
5. 未来云操作系统将朝哪方面发展?
未来云操作系统将更加智能化,集成边缘计算和人工智能技术,以提供更高效、更符合用户需求的解决方案。
